Following the release of the Massachusetts House of Representatives Ways and Means Committee’s annual budget last week, totaling just over $40.3 billion, deliberations are scheduled to begin Monday, April 24.

The Massachusetts League of Community Health Centers has filed three amendments on behalf of community health centers:

• Amendment #818: Community Health Centers, filed by Representative Livingstone, would increase Community Health Center rates by October 1, 2017 by eight (8) percent in FY18 and by no less than four (4) percent annually thereafter.

• Amendment #969: Community Health Center Primary Care Workforce Development and Loan Forgiveness Grant Program, filed by Representative Cassidy, would fund a primary care workforce development and loan forgiveness grant program at a level of $500,000.

• Amendment #1050: Infrastructure and Capacity Building Grants, filed by Representative Cronin, would direct $10 million in ICB funds to health centers.
